'SECRET FLEETS' NOW AVAILABLE IN THE SIA SHOP


 

3rd August 2011

The SIA today announced that it had added a new title from the Western Australian Museum.  Secret Fleets tells how the Port of Fremantle became host to over 170 Allied submarines from the navies of the United States, Britain and the Netherlands.  Those submarines made a total of 416 war patrols out of the port, famously achieving the second-highest tonnage sunk during the war.  Visit the SIA shop to read more and place an order online.
